In case you missed it, the hottest team in the Turkish Airlines EuroLeague over the last 10 games is Partizan Mozzart Bet Belgrade, which now finds itself in the playoff zone for the first time this season after its first double-round sweep.
Partizan took Zalgiris Kaunas’s best punch and delivered a knockout blow in the fourth quarter for a 74-88 road win. That came on the heels of a 92-71 victory over LDLC ASVEL Villeurbanne to give the 1992 EuroLeague champs a 12-11 mark and eight wins in the last 10 games. That also leaves Partizan atop a four-way tie at 12-11 for seventh place in the standings.
"We’re just growing with time. We have the most inexperienced team in EuroLeague and it was going to take time. But now we’re just growing and trying to get better and get to know each other, listen to each other and realize it’s us against everyone," said Zach LeDay, who collected 11 points and 10 rebounds against his former team Zalgiris.
